REFLECTION NOTES
UTILIZATION OF PERSONAL STRENTGHS TO UPHOLD THE DIGNITY OF
TEACHING AS A PROFESSION
As an educator, I recognize that upholding the dignity of teaching as a
profession requires continuous self-improvement, collaboration, and
dedication to fostering a positive teaching and learning culture. I have
utilized my personal and professional strengths—effective communication,
adaptability, and a passion for student development—to contribute
meaningfully to my school community.
One instance where I applied these strengths was during our National
Reading Program for Grade 2 for low reading skills. Recognizing the
urgency of literacy development, I worked closely with colleagues to design
structured reading activities tailored to students' needs. I facilitated
engaging reading sessions and guided struggling readers patiently, helping
them build confidence. My ability to connect with students and differentiate
instruction proved essential in making reading a more accessible and
enjoyable experience.
I provided them with simple yet effective strategies, such as using
phonics-based approaches and reading aloud together. Additionally, my
colleagues consulted me for suggestions on improving lesson delivery,
especially in Peace Education and Values Education. Through
collaboration, we integrated more interactive and reflective activities that
made learning more meaningful for students.
Furthermore, I played an active role in Health Education sessions for
Grades 1-3 learners. My organizational skills were evident in planning well-
structured lessons on personal hygiene and disease prevention. During our
school’s health awareness campaign, I assisted in coordinating activities and
ensuring that students understood the importance of maintaining proper
hygiene practices.

By leveraging my strengths in communication, collaboration, and
instructional design, I have contributed to creating a supportive and
engaging school environment. These experiences have reinforced my belief
that teaching is not just about delivering lessons but about making a lasting
impact on students, colleagues, and the broader school community.
